The Early Foundations: Bedouin Culture and Trade

Pre-Islamic and Islamic Eras

Long before the discovery of oil, the UAE was home to nomadic Bedouin tribes who thrived in the harsh desert environment. These tribes were skilled in navigation, trade, and survival, relying on camel herding, pearl diving, and fishing.

The region’s strategic location along ancient trade routes made it a crucial link between Mesopotamia, the Indus Valley, and East Africa. The arrival of Islam in the 7th century further shaped the cultural and political landscape, with the UAE becoming part of the broader Islamic world.

The Age of Maritime Trade

By the 16th century, European powers began eyeing the Gulf for its trade potential. The Portuguese, followed by the British, established influence over the region. The coastal settlements of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and Sharjah became key trading posts, dealing in pearls, spices, and textiles.

However, the pearl industry—once the backbone of the economy—collapsed in the early 20th century due to the invention of cultured pearls in Japan. This economic shock forced the region to seek new avenues for survival.


The Birth of a Nation: From Trucial States to UAE

British Influence and the Trucial States

In the 19th century, the British signed a series of treaties with local sheikhdoms, establishing the "Trucial States" (a term derived from "truce"). These agreements provided British protection in exchange for control over foreign affairs, ensuring stability in a region prone to tribal conflicts.

The Discovery of Oil and Economic Transformation

The game-changer came in the 1950s and 60s with the discovery of vast oil reserves in Abu Dhabi. Sheikh Zayed bin Sultan Al Nahyan, the ruler of Abu Dhabi, recognized the potential of this resource to modernize the region. His leadership was instrumental in uniting the seven emirates into a single federation.

On December 2, 1971, the UAE was officially formed, with Abu Dhabi as its capital and Sheikh Zayed as its first president. Dubai, under Sheikh Rashid bin Saeed Al Maktoum, also began its rapid ascent as a trade and tourism hub.


The UAE in the 21st Century: A Global Player

Economic Diversification Beyond Oil

While oil wealth laid the foundation for the UAE’s prosperity, its leaders understood the need to diversify. Today, the UAE is a leader in:

  • Tourism & Real Estate (Dubai’s Burj Khalifa, Palm Jumeirah)
  • Finance & Trade (Dubai International Financial Centre, Abu Dhabi Global Market)
  • Technology & Innovation (AI initiatives, Mars Mission)

Sustainability and Climate Leadership

Despite being an oil-rich nation, the UAE is investing heavily in renewable energy. The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um Solar Park is one of the world’s largest solar projects, and the country has pledged Net Zero by 2050.

The UAE’s hosting of COP28 in 2023 further cemented its role in global climate discussions, balancing its hydrocarbon economy with green ambitions.

Geopolitical Influence and Diplomacy

The UAE has emerged as a key mediator in regional conflicts, maintaining relations with both Western powers and non-aligned nations. Its Abraham Accords agreement with Israel in 2020 marked a historic shift in Middle Eastern diplomacy.

However, challenges remain, including tensions with Iran, involvement in Yemen, and balancing relations with Saudi Arabia amid regional rivalries.


Cultural Evolution: Tradition Meets Modernity

Preserving Heritage in a Fast-Changing Society

While skyscrapers dominate the skyline, the UAE remains deeply connected to its roots. Initiatives like:

  • Al Ain Oasis (a UNESCO World Heritage Site)
  • Sharjah’s Cultural District
  • Dubai’s Heritage Villages

ensure that Emirati traditions, from falconry to Arabic poetry, are preserved for future generations.

Expatriates and Multiculturalism

Over 80% of the UAE’s population consists of expatriates, making it one of the most diverse nations in the world. This multiculturalism has fueled innovation but also raises questions about labor rights and long-term citizenship policies.


Future Challenges and Opportunities

Post-Oil Economy: Can the UAE Sustain Its Growth?

With global shifts toward renewable energy, the UAE must continue diversifying. Investments in AI, space exploration (the Hope Probe to Mars), and fintech suggest a forward-thinking approach.

Social Reforms and Human Rights

Recent changes—such as allowing cohabitation for unmarried couples, alcohol law relaxations, and women’s empowerment—signal gradual liberalization. Yet, critics argue more reforms are needed in labor and free speech laws.

Global Competition: Staying Ahead in a Shifting World

As Saudi Arabia’s Vision 2030 and Qatar’s World Cup investments reshape the Gulf, the UAE must maintain its edge in innovation, tourism, and business-friendly policies.
